National Heart, Lung, and Blood Advisory Council February Meeting
February 15, 2012
Dr. Shurin welcomed members to the 245th meeting of the National Heart, Lung, and Blood Advisory Council.
Dr. Shurin welcomed three new Council members: Dr. Pamela Douglas, Ursula Geller Professor of Research in Cardiovascular
Diseases, Duke University School of Medicine; Dr. Ron King, Chief Science and Business Officer and Co-Founder, Bio-Accel; and
Dr. Barbara Konkle, Director, Translational Research, Puget Sound Blood Center.
Dr Shurin updated the Council on NHLBI leadership appointments: Mr. Ariel Herman is the new Deputy Executive Officer for
the Institute and Dr. Jamie Siegel is the new Chief of the Hemostasis and Thrombosis Branch in the Division of Blood Diseases
and Resources.
Dr. Shurin announced that beginning in 2013, February Council – like September Council – will be a virtual meeting.
Dr. Kathy Hudson, Deputy Director for Science, Outreach, and Policy at the NIH and Acting Deputy Director of the National
Center for Advancing Translational Sciences (NCATS) updated the Council on revising the Common Rule on protection of human
subjects. She also noted that the NIH will be devoting $1 million in bioethics research funding to the development of an
evolving, evidence-based approach to ensure effective protection of human subjects.
Dr. Shurin informed the Council of NIH leadership appointments: Dr. Thomas R. Insel, Director, National Institute of
Mental Health, has been appointed Acting Director of the NCATS and Dr. M. Roy Wilson has been appointed Deputy Director,
Strategic Scientific Planning and Program Coordination, for the National Institute on Minority Health and Health Disparities.
Dr. Shurin discussed the FY 2013 President's Budget. The proposed NHLBI budget remains relatively flat overall, with a
total increase of just over 0.02%, or approximately $709 thousand. However, the Research Project Grant (RPG) line would
decrease slightly, in part due to a mandated increase in Small Business Innovation Research/Small Business Technology
Transfer funding from 2.95% in FY 2012 to 3.05% in FY 2013.
The Institute remains committed to the idea that fully-funded strategic investments are more likely to thrive than investments
receiving across-the-board cuts. The Institute will also continue to support three main scientific priorities: discovery
research (including genomics, systems biology, and modeling), regenerative medicine, and translational research.
Dr. Shurin discussed the Council on the Global Alliance for Chronic Disease, of which she is now the chair.
Dr. Arun Chockalingam, Director of the NHLBI Office of Global Health (OGH), discussed the role of the OGH in facilitating
and coordinating global health efforts across the NHLBI; interacting with other NIH Institutes and Centers, the Department of
Health and Human Services, and the U.S. Department of State; linking with other national and international organizations; and
managing programs in partnership with NHLBI program divisions.
Dr. Denise Simons-Morton, Director of the NHLBI Division for the Application of Research Discoveries, presented background
and the current approach on development of NHLBI-sponsored clinical practice guidelines. She noted that review and clearance
of guideline reports now includes Council review.
Dr. Stephen Daniels, Department of Pediatrics, University of Colorado School of Medicine and Children's Hospital Colorado;
and Chair, Expert Panel on Integrated Guidelines for CV Risk Reduction in Children and Adolescents, discussed the guidelines,
which were released in December 2011. He noted that guidelines should not be considered a final product, but rather a
continuously revised one that evolves along with their evidence base.
Dr. Stephen Mockrin, Director, Division of Extramural Research Activities, NHLBI, presented the delegated authorities to
the Council. Delegated authorities allow NHLBI staff to perform specific functions without Council involvement, thereby
adding flexibility and decreasing the burden on the Council. The Council agreed to continue the current policy of
Delegated Authorities for another year.
